    Hey everyone,

    I picked up another xbox debug kit a while ago and on the HDD is a build of 'Fear Factor Unleashed'. I have done some research on this and it seems it was due to be released on xbox, ps2 and gba but it only ever made it out on gba.

    HIP Interactive released the gba version and I presume they were making the xbox version too but what is throwing me is that there is also a build of State of Emergency on here too with is a Rockstar/ VIS game.

    I have played it a little bit but it is very buggy and if you fall off the designated path you basically have to restart the whole game.
    I will try get some screen shots and maybe a video.

    Does anyone know of this being released anywhere? Anyone have anymore information on it?

    Took some pictures of the unit up and running last night.

    This is the XDK Launcher with the programs saved on the HDD.

    On selection of the Fear Factor app it fires you straight into gameplay (first picture). There are no intro screens or even a title screen. Pressing the start button brings up the menu which allows you to exit the level back to the main menu (second picture)
    [​IMG]
    [​IMG]

    The main menu is a basic scroll selection (see pic) and has the following -
    Fear Factor (Takes you to the character selection list, see pics below)
    Xbox Live (Requires you to sign in)
    Custom (Brings up a menu of - Number of players, Game type and AI Skill)
    Practise (Brings up the level menu)
    Multiplayer (Brings up a menu of - Number of players, Game type, AI Skill, Order of Play, Handicaps and Taunts)
    Video Gallery (Not selectable)
    Options (Brings up a menu of - Profiles, Audio and Video & Camera)
    Records (Not Selectable)
    Help (Not selectable)

    There are also 4 characters which are shaded out and say 'Character Locked' above them. Not sure if they will be unlockable or not.
    Once you have selected your character it takes you to a level menu (much like the main menu list, I forgot to take a pic) and the following levels are listed - (any with a * are not selectable)

    Madness Mountain *
    Red Hot River
    Barrel Blast
    The Mouth of Hell
    Skyreach *
    Suicidal Slide
    Rooftop Rock n Retch
    Sky High Scramble
    Gator Glade *
    Swamp Swerve n Spew
    Moonshine Meltdown
    Gator Bait Gauntlet
    Apocalypse City *
    Detonation Derby
    Wrecking Run
    Armageddon Alley
    Frozen by Fear *
    Cable Carnage
    Brake Bounce n Barf
    Alpine Assault

    Once you have selected the level you wish to play it gives you basic instructions of what you have to do (collect flags, finish in a certain time etc...) It looks as though non of the levels are finished. If you fall from a platform it is impossible to get back to where you need to be, you basically have to restart the whole game.
    There is no music and no sound effects on any of the levels. If you leave the main menu screen to itself for maybe 15 seconds it loads a small demo which looks like -
